openclaw skills install uptime-kumaManage Uptime Kuma monitors via CLI wrapper around the Socket.IO API.
Requires uptime-kuma-api Python package:
pip install uptime-kuma-api
Environment variables (set in shell or Clawdbot config):
UPTIME_KUMA_URL - Server URL (e.g., http://localhost:3001)UPTIME_KUMA_USERNAME - Login usernameUPTIME_KUMA_PASSWORD - Login passwordScript location: scripts/kuma.py
# Overall status summary
python scripts/kuma.py status
# List all monitors
python scripts/kuma.py list
python scripts/kuma.py list --json
# Get monitor details
python scripts/kuma.py get <id>
# Add monitors
python scripts/kuma.py add --name "My Site" --type http --url https://example.com
python scripts/kuma.py add --name "Server Ping" --type ping --hostname 192.168.1.1
python scripts/kuma.py add --name "SSH Port" --type port --hostname server.local --port 22
# Pause/resume monitors
python scripts/kuma.py pause <id>
python scripts/kuma.py resume <id>
# Delete monitor
python scripts/kuma.py delete <id>
# View heartbeat history
python scripts/kuma.py heartbeats <id> --hours 24
# List notification channels
python scripts/kuma.py notifications
http - HTTP/HTTPS endpointping - ICMP pingport - TCP port checkkeyword - HTTP + keyword searchdns - DNS resolutiondocker - Docker containerpush - Push-based (passive)mysql, postgres, mongodb, redis - Database checksmqtt - MQTT brokergroup - Monitor groupCheck what's down:
python scripts/kuma.py status
python scripts/kuma.py list # Look for 🔴
Add HTTP monitor with 30s interval:
python scripts/kuma.py add --name "API Health" --type http --url https://api.example.com/health --interval 30
Maintenance mode (pause all):
for id in $(python scripts/kuma.py list --json | jq -r '.[].id'); do
python scripts/kuma.py pause $id
done
